NEW ORLEANS – The 2017 schedule begins this weekend for the Alcorn State University baseball program when it plays three SWAC opponents in non-conference, neutral site contests at the MLB Youth Academy Wesley Barrow Stadium.
Â
Alcorn will begin with a 5 p.m. game Friday against Grambling State, followed by a 2 p.m. start versus Prairie View A&M on Saturday and a 3 p.m. first-pitch Sunday against Southern. Charles Edmond will have Friday and Sunday's games live on radio on wprl.org.
Â
None of the games will go on the team's conference records.
Â
The Braves finished in third-place in the SWAC East Division last year with a 16-36 overall record and 10-14 in league play. They brought back four of their eight starting field players and seven of their 12 pitchers.
Â
Leading the team at the plate is senior infielder
Walter Vives. He hit for a .331 batting average and .394 on-base percentage last season. Junior infielder
Wallace Rios Jimenez is another big bat returning after hitting .307 with a .393 OBP last year.
Â
The pitching rotation will include junior
Jahborus Smith and seniors
Regynold Johnson and Austin-Willie Greene. Smith and Johnson recorded three wins apiece last year, while Willis-Greene is a transfer from St. Catharine College where he earned All-Conference accolades.
Â
Head coach
Bretton Richardson enters his second season at the helm. He brought in a new assistant coach
David Duncan who pitched at Florida A&M before playing two years professionally. Richardson also kept
Cedric Bell as a graduate assistant after he earned All-Conference Second-Team honors in 2016.
Â
Alcorn's home opener will be Monday at noon when it welcomes Murray State to Willie E. "Rat" McGowan Stadium.
